A helical gear motor combines an electric motor with helical gears to reduce speed and increase torque. The "helical" part refers to the shape of the gear teeth. Instead of straight-cut teeth like in spur gears, helical gears have slanted teeth, which engage more gradually and smoothly.
This smoother engagement means:
Less vibration and noise
Higher load capacity
Better efficiency and longer life
Basically, the motor spins, the helical gears reduce the speed while boosting torque, and the result is a powerful, controlled mechanical output that’s perfect for heavy-duty tasks.
These motors are the unsung heroes in a variety of industries. Here are just a few examples:
Food & Beverage Processing: For conveyor belts that move bottles or packages at just the right speed.
Material Handling: In warehouse lifts, sorters, and packaging lines.
HVAC Systems: For fans and blowers that need consistent, quiet operation.
Agriculture Equipment: In feed machines and mixers.
Automated Production Lines: Robots and actuators rely on the precision of gear motors.
